I just finished building my F1-5 the other day and thought I'd share some pictures of my build. I have yet to maiden it but plan to ASAP

Parts list:
Cobra 2204 2300kv
Little bees 20a
SeriouslyDodo FC running betaflight
X4r
HS1177 Camera
Micro MinimOSD
Hawkeye 200mw VTX

I used that red mesh on my last build, but I kept melting it when I tried to heat up the heat shrink. It also made the cables more rigid. This isn't necessarily a bad thing, but it can make the servo connectors easier to pull loose. My board power pulled loose once about 50ft over a stone patio.

I made the mistake of trying to fit all pins on my naze rev 6, and I put some on top and some on bottom. I underestimated how much height that would eat up. Luckily, there's just enough room to sick my d4r-ii under the pdb. This micro frame is tough to fit everything in. Really glad I decided to go with the micro minim.

Finally got my motors and went to mount them, but the hole pattern makes the wire exit perpendicular to the arm. I thought the 4b was supposed to have mounting that made wires run parallel to the arm. I've got the RTFQ 2204 2300kv motors on the 4mm frame. Is it possible that my frame got made with the wrong orientation of hole pattern?
Nov 18, 2015, 07:15 PM
Intense
You have to flip the plate I think, f1 writing will not be as pretty tho lol.

As not all 2204 motors have the 16 and 19 mm pattern the same way
